Minneapolis-Moline ZB

The Minneapolis-Moline ZB is a classic tractor with a manual steering system and a simple transmission. It has 5 forward gears and 1 reverse gear, giving farmers good control over their work. The tractor runs on a gasoline engine made by Minneapolis-Moline itself. This engine has 4 cylinders and is cooled by liquid, which helps keep it running smoothly. The ZB's engine is naturally aspirated, meaning it doesn't use a turbocharger. It has a displacement of 206 cubic inches, which is average for tractors of its time. The engine runs at 1500 RPM when working hard. The tractor uses a 12-volt electrical system and has an electric starter, making it easy to get going. It stands 74 inches tall and has agricultural tires on both front and back. The front tires are 16 inches in diameter, while the rear tires are much bigger at 38 inches, giving the tractor good traction in the field.
